成Windows客戶端的原理其實并不復雜。簡單來說,就是使用一種叫作“WebView”的技術將網站內容嵌入到一個Windows應用程序中。WebView是一種可以在應用程序中加載HTML頁面的控件,通過使用WebView,我們可以在Windows客戶端中加載并顯示網站內容。因此,我們只需要創建一個包含WebView控件的應用程序,將其指向我們的網站地址,就可以將網站打包成Windows客戶端了。
二、詳細教程
下面,我們將通過一個簡單的示例來演示如何將網站打包成Windows客戶端。
1.安裝必要的開發工具
首先,我們需要安裝一個支持構建Windows應用程序的開發環境。在本教程中,我們將使用Microsoft Visual Studio作為開發工具。您可以訪問以下鏈接下載并安裝Microsoft Visual Studio:
https://visualstudio.microsoft.com/zh-hans/vs/
安裝過程中,請確保您安裝了“使用C#開發的Windows桌面”組件。
2.創建一個新的Windows應用程序項目
打開Visual Studio,點擊“開始”->“創建新項目”。在項目模板列表中選擇“Windows Forms 應用程序”(C#),并單擊“下一步”。為項目指定一個名稱以及存儲位置,然后單擊“創建”。
3.向項目中添加WebView控件
在新創建的Windo網站轉appws應用程序項目中,我們需要向主窗口中添加WebView控件。首先,在Visual Studio的“工具箱”窗口中尋找“WebView”控件。如果找不到,你可能需要添加 WebView2 擴展庫,具體操作可以參考:
https://docs.microsoft.com/zh-cn/microsoft-edge/webview2/gettingstarted/winforms
將“WebView”拖放到主窗口的設計表面上。然后,可將WebView控件調整為填滿整個窗口。也可以在窗口的屬性窗口中找到“Dock”屬性,并將其設置為“Fill”。
4.編寫代碼加載網站內容
現在,我們需要編寫一些代碼來加載我們的網站內容。雙擊主窗口以打開其代碼視圖,然后在“Form1”的構造函數中添加以下代碼:
“`
public Form1()
{
InitializeComponent();
webView1.Navigate(“https://www.example.com/”); // 將此處的網址替換為您的網站地址
}
“`
請將上述代碼中的“https://www.example.com/”替換為您自己的網站地址。
5.構建和運行Windows客戶端
至此,我們已經完成了所有必要的準備工作。現在,只需單擊Visual Studio工具欄上的“啟動”按鈕,即可啟動并運行我們的Windows客戶端。如果一切順利,您應該可以看到主窗口中顯示了您的網站內容。
結束語
通過上面的教程,您應該已經學會了如何將網站打包成Windows客戶端。雖然這個過程相對簡單,但它為用戶提供了一種更加便捷的訪問方式,這對于那些希望擴大用戶群體的網站來說是非常有價值的。如果您對這個過程有任何疑問,請隨時在評論區提問,我們將竭力為您解答。